Description

A colourful wreath which decorates our corridor right behind the front door. For this project I bought a polystyrol wreath from the craftstore and wrapped it with fabric and ribbon. Then I made a bunch of kanzashi flowers and butterflies in various sizes and pinned them to the wreath until I liked the arrangement. The craft patterns are from various sources. As a last step I fixed all flowers to the wreath with a hot glue gun.
